Output 015442ed15f5a24b9dbb87d17f7ca429b3ab96e02a1983e933fc153161bf6774:1

value
586430
script pubkey
OP_0 OP_PUSHBYTES_20 74058c103d26948df5079f79386a26cc43438de3
address
ltc1qwszccypay62gmag8nauns63xe3p58r0rv9trj2
transaction
015442ed15f5a24b9dbb87d17f7ca429b3ab96e02a1983e933fc153161bf6774
spent
true